All Saints' Day is a Catholic solemnity on November 1st to honor all saints in heaven, both known and unknown. It originated from the early Church's practice of commemorating martyrs and evolved into a universal feast day due to the growing number of saints.


All Souls' Day is a Catholic day of prayer and remembrance for the faithful departed, observed annually on November 2nd. Catholics believe this day is for praying for souls so they can enter heaven. It is a time for remembering loved ones, praying for their souls, attending Mass, and visiting cemeteries to decorate graves.
